A 0 percent purchase credit card allows you to make purchases without paying interest for a certain period of time, typically ranging from 6 to 18 months. This can help you save money by avoiding interest charges on your purchases during the promotional period. It can be beneficial for managing large purchases or consolidating debt, as long as you pay off the balance before the promotional period ends to avoid high interest rates.
